2. Characteristics :
Remark: Reference level for the relative attenuation arel of the TFS 35A is the minimum of the pass band attenuation amin. The minimum of the
pass band attenuation amin is defined as the insertion loss ae. The reference frequency fc is the arithmetic mean value of the upper and lower
frequencies at the 3 dB filter attenuation level relative to the insertion loss ae. . The nominal frequency fN is fixed at 35,42 MHz without tolerance.
All specified values are guarantied in operating temperature range.
Measurement of filter response will be done at temperatures of 40°C , 25°C and 85°C for each part.
